目录打包编写DockerFile构建镜像创建容器并启动容器测试打包使用maven或者其他构建工具,打包可运行jar或者war,这里使用可运行jar进行部署。编写DockerFile创建构建目录,复制jar到构建目录,并编写Dockerfile如下;#基础镜像,在openjdk8的基础上构建 FROM openjdk:8 #维护人信息 MAINTAINER weihao weihao322@16
Charles是一款抓神器,它是Java开发的跨平台的软件,不仅可以在Mac上使用,Linux以及Window下都是可以使用的,当然需要安装JDK,才能运行,他是收费的,需要进行破解.破解操作:将下载的文件里的Charles.jar 替换掉包内容里的Charles.jar即可HTTP抓http抓比较简单,基本上只要打开了charles,然后随便一个网络请求,就可以在charles中看到抓取的
 如何把项目打jar,然后暴露接口给第三方应用提供服务【实战讲解】下面这个例子,是我在开源项目CR949中使用到的部分代码,作为讲解,发布到这里。jar中的controller,如何对外暴露接口。 这样一个场景:比如,我去gitee上面,下载一个项目,打成jar。现在呢,我想把这个jar中的一个接口暴露出来,这样我本地项目启动以后, 我就可以直接访问这个接口了。例如我们的项目启动时
转载 2023-09-08 20:38:34
458阅读
一. 如何运行jar? 这个文章真好!!! Linux 运行jar命令如下:1. 方式一:java -jar test.jar特点:当前ssh窗口被锁定,可按CTRL + C打断程序运行,或直接关闭窗口,程序退出那如何让窗口不锁定?2. 方式二:java -jar test.jar &&代表在后台运行。特定:当前ssh窗口不被锁定,但是当窗口关闭时,程序中止运行。继续改进,如何
# Java获取服务 在Java中,我们经常需要使用各种服务来完成特定的任务。通过获取服务,我们可以方便地使用这些服务。本文将介绍如何在Java中获取服务,并提供相应的代码示例。 ## 什么是服务服务是Java中的一个概念,它提供了一种机制来让开发者获取特定类型的服务服务通常包含了一组接口和实现类,开发者可以通过获取服务来使用这些接口和实现类。 Java平台自身提供了许
原创 2023-08-15 06:48:19
33阅读
一,微服务1,什么是微服务?微服务化的核心就是将传统的一站式应用,根据业务拆分成一个一个的服务,彻底 地去耦合,每一个微服务提供单个业务功能的服务,一个服务做一件事, 从技术角度看就是一种小而独立的处理过程,类似进程概念,能够自行单独启动 或销毁,拥有自己独立的数据库。2,微服务与微服务架构【微服务】 强调的是服务的大小,它关注的是某一个点,是具体解决某一个问题/提供落地对应服务的一个服务应用,狭
(一)软件简介Rsync是一个远程数据同步工具,可通过LAN/WAN快速同步多台主机间的文件。Rsync本来是用以取代rcp的一个工具,它当前由rsync.samba.org维护。Rsync使用所谓的“Rsync演算法”来使本地和远程两个主机之间的文件达到同步,这个算法只传送两个文件的不同部分,而不是每次都整份传送,因此速度相当快。运行Rsync server的机器也叫backup server,
第一种方法: 1, 准备工具 Hello.jar: 可运行的。这里我的是最简单的say helloworld! Main函数所在类路径:org.springframework.boot.loader.JarLauncher(这个是一般springboot项目的启动类), JavaService: 下载地址http://download.forge.ow2.org/javaservice/Java
转载 2023-08-01 11:20:42
82阅读
摘要经常会有同学遇到api通过ip可以访问,但是通过域名却不可以访问。本篇文章总结了造成这种情况可能的原因。 因为与具体技术的选型、规则配置有关,所以没有深入讨论,只是列出可能性,仅供参考。分析问题通过域名访问不到的请求表现的现象有接口返回404一个错误页面提示method type不支持提示接口缺乏必要的参数这些都是接口访问不到,2是配置了错误页面;3,4则发出的POST/PUT 请求,但是请求
Service 是一个可以在后台执行长时间运行操作而不提供用户界面的应用组件。服务可由其他应用组件启动,而且即使用户切换到其他应用,服务仍将在后台继续运行。 此外,组件可以绑定到服务,以与之进行交互,甚至是执行进程间通信 (IPC)。 例如,服务可以处理网络事务、播放音乐,执行文件 I/O 或与内容提供程序交互,而所有这一切均可在后台进行。 服务基本上分为两种形式:启动 当应用组件(如 Act
转载 2023-08-10 13:37:50
95阅读
文章目录Centos7----NFS服务器配置rpm安装配置文件配置服务开启开启端口显示共享目录状态客户端配置查看目标服务器共享目录状态实现挂载查看挂载 Centos7----NFS服务器配置 rpm安装 NFS服务涉及两个主要的rpm,rpcbind和nfs-utils。有两种方法安装,一种,直接使用yum install xxxx进行安装;另外一种获取这两个以及它所依赖的
编写背景:本人负责某银行的一个项目主力开发,在与第三方调试接口时遇到了一个问题:对方服务器明明给了我返回的值,但我这边却没有收到,日志中没有打印对应的值。一开始我认为是对方的问题,但是对方就丢了一句“我试了有的”,然后我就一个人风中凌乱。随即我就想到了抓的方式进行验证,看到底是哪一方的问题导致的。因为日志可能会骗人,但是抓是不会的。抓的概念:抓顾名思义就是抓取数据,基本上与第三方通讯就会
转载 2023-07-24 21:17:54
297阅读
删除mysql服务-散mysql官网上下载了需要的mysql版本。安装完
原创 2022-11-08 19:00:58
33阅读
# Java 微服务常量 在开发Java微服务时,常常需要定义一些常量来表示不变的值,比如错误码、状态码、配置信息等。为了统一管理这些常量并提高代码的可读性和可维护性,我们可以使用常量的方式来组织这些常量。 ## 什么是Java微服务常量? Java微服务常量是一个专门存放常量的Java,通常包含多个常量类。每个常量类对应一个模块或者一类常量,其中定义了多个静态final字段来表示
原创 2月前
9阅读
# Java命名规范及服务层设计 在Java开发中,良好的命名规范和服务层设计是非常重要的。命名规范能够让代码结构更加清晰,易于维护和扩展;而服务层的设计则是整个应用程序的核心,负责处理业务逻辑和数据操作。本文将介绍Java命名规范,并通过一个示例详细说明服务层的设计。 ## Java命名规范 在Java中,名通常采用反转域名的方式命名,以确保名的唯一性。例如,如果公司域名为e
原创 1月前
15阅读
如何把可执行jar部署为windows服务网上有很多种把可执行jar部署为windows服务的方法,本次要说的是使用Apache Commons Daemon来部署windows服务。通过官方文档很容易掌握这种方法。1 下载 Apache Commons Daemon进入下载页面,默认是最新版本。如果想下载历史版本的程序,需要从archives…页面下载。 目录binaries文件中,可以找到
1、HTTP协议介绍HTTP协议是Hyper Text Transfer Protocol(超文本传输协议)的缩写,是用于从万维网(WWW:World Wide Web )服务器传输超文本(也可以说是资源)到本地浏览器的传送协议。 HTTP协议是基于TCP协议的应用层协议,它不关心数据在底层传输的细节(底层细节需要很多网络方面的知识,这里不扩展说明),主要是用来规定客户端和服务端的数据传输格式
# Docker 查看服务路径 Docker 是一种容器化平台,可以在不同的操作系统上运行容器化的应用程序。在使用 Docker 构建和管理容器时,有时候需要查看容器中服务路径,以便进行调试和分析。 本文将介绍如何使用 Docker 查看服务路径,并提供代码示例帮助读者更好地理解。 ## 什么是 Docker Docker 是一个开源的平台,用于快速构建、测试和部署应用程序的容器化
原创 6月前
31阅读
# Python本地服务 在网络通信中,抓是一种常见的技术手段,用于捕获和分析网络数据。Python作为一种强大的编程语言,提供了丰富的库和工具来实现本地服务。本文将介绍使用Python进行本地服务的方法,并提供代码示例。 ## 什么是本地服务 本地服务是指在本机上运行的服务的数据捕获和分析。在软件开发过程中,我们经常需要调试网络请求、分析数据内容、模拟网络故障等
原创 9月前
84阅读
  • 1
  • 2
  • 3
  • 4
  • 5